What is a key fob?
Key fobs are remote control that allows you open and start your vehicle without the need to insert a key of metal into the ignition. It is a lightweight, small device that contains a microchip that holds information such as an unique ID as well as an antenna to send and receive signals. The microchip transmits radio frequencies with the receiver inside your vehicle. These signals are a type of near-field communications (NFC) which allow payment via contactless, as well as other features that require proximity.
Depending on the type of key fob you own, it will offer different features. Certain systems, for instance keep track of who was in the building and when. This can be very useful in preventing theft. There are also security measures that can be added to the system, such as encrypted keys that make it more difficult to copy them. Prox cards are a popular fob type, and are often called 125khz cards, 26-bit proxy, or proximity fobs.

How do I open a key fob
It's frustrating to discover that your Mazda key fob doesn't work. A lost key fob could disrupt your plans regardless of whether you're preparing for work or coming home after an having a fun day at EAA Airventure.
It's easy to change your key fob batteries at home with a few simple tools. Holiday Mazda's Service team has put together this guide to help you open the keyfob to replace batteries.
To start, push the auxiliary key button on the back of your key fob to remove the auxiliary key made of steel. Once the key has been removed, there should be an opening on either side of the case. The case should be opened using a tape-wrapped screwdriver. It should break easily without damaging the rubber ring underneath that the battery rests on.
Now that the battery is exposed remove the old one out and set it aside in a place where you will not forget it. Then, place the new battery in its place ensuring that the positive (+) side of the battery is facing up. After the battery is in place, you can close the case making sure both sides snap into the correct position. Then you can use your Mazda keyfob once more.
What's the battery used in a key fob?
Most key fobs have small, coin-shaped batteries that are known as button cells. These batteries can be found in many places including general stores, home improvement centers and auto parts stores. It is important to get the right size battery for your key fob due to the fact that various sizes of batteries have different discharge characteristics that can influence how well your key fob functions.
Most of the time you can determine whether your fob battery is dead by pressing any buttons on it and then looking at the LED light that is illuminated. If the LED light does not blink, it indicates that the battery is dead and has to be replaced. You can also check the battery with a voltage meter to determine what voltage it's operating at. A fully charged key fob battery should read around 3 Volts. If the battery reads less than that,
